o The Cove is elegantly situated between Cove and Paradise Beaches creating the feeling of being cast away on a private, white-sand sanctuary. The luxury property was designed by architect Jeffrey Beers to bring high design together with the bluest ocean and mother of pearl hued sand. The result is an open air lobby that rises and sets with the day, an exclusive pool that sits between two private beaches, stunning and sensual rooms and suites, a collection of unparalleled dining and purposeful service delivered with Bahamian warmth.

We have stayed here several times and only learned upon arrival that COVE is no longer adult only. Massive disappointment but we should have read the fine print. Room is definitely showing its age with frayed carpet and mold in shower. Not representative of a $1700+ a night experience. What is advertised as “adult only” pool is not. At least 20% of guests are under 18 making it even harder to find a precious lounge chair. Rigor should be amplied or just call it a regular pool. $150 room service breakfast took an hour and arrived cold. $15 for single glass of OJ. Really! I get that’s it’s an island and that everything is grossly expense but between 20% VAT and obligatory 15% tip on everything your forced to pay 25% premium on top. Why even call it a tip if it’s obligatory. Just call it another of the many fees! As this experience is not what we expected we plan to leave a day early. Requested conversation with leadership regarding one night refund or credit towards hotel amenities. Was quickly dismissed and told nothing could be done. No flexibility in room Carmines: no option for half portion makes it silly for couples who want different food. It’s already impossible to get reservations at hotel restaurants and this policy makes it even harder Nice gym but crowded and too small for a property of this size Staff kind and professional overall. Mandatory tip policy dilutes culture of high performance. Overall property remains impressive with great location and potential for next chapter in what was a 1st class gold standard in the past but they have a long way to go. A good start would be to place quality ahead of profit. Abandon the required 25% up charge on everything and cultivate performance based environment .

We were 2 families with 3 kids (11 year olds) and everyone adults and kids had a blast. the water park is beyond amazing and every ride is well thought through. There are rides for daredevils as well as for people who want a pleasant non-scary experience. The pools were everywhere and well maintained. The ocean was right next to the resort and water was warm and swimmable and one could also snorkel. Overall, highly recommend this place - only negative is the food - it's expensive and not the most variety for vegetarians.
